npm 包 babel-plugin-transform-function-composition-name 使用教程

阅读时长 3 分钟读完

什么是 babel-plugin-transform-function-composition-name?

babel-plugin-transform-function-composition-name 是一个用于修改函数变量名的 Babel 插件。它可以将函数变量名改为不同的名称,并且可以自定义需要修改的函数以及变量名。这个插件可以帮助前端开发人员更好地理解代码中的函数调用。

如何使用?

安装

首先需要安装插件:

配置

通过在 babel 配置文件中使用该插件,可以对代码中的函数变量名进行修改。下面是一个示例配置:

-- -------------------- ---- -------
-
  ---------- -
    -
      ---------------------------------------------------
      -
        ------------ ----------- -------------
        -------- ------- --------
      -
    -
  -
-

在以上示例中,函数变量名为 getData 和 fetchData,它们将被更改为 get 和 fetch。可以根据自己的需要添加或修改函数名称和变量名。

例子

下面是一个示例代码片段,我们将使用 babel-plugin-transform-function-composition-name 对其进行修改:

-- -------------------- ---- -------
----- --------- - ----- --- -- -
  ----- -------- - ----- -----------
  ------ ----------------
--

----- ----------- - ----- ---- -- -
  --- -
    ----- ------------- - ----- ------------------
    ------ --------------
  - ----- ------- -
    ---------------------
  -
--

----- ------- - ----- -- -- -
  ----- ---- - ----- -----------------------
  ----- ------------- - ----- ------------------
  ------ --------------
--

在运行了以上代码片段,我们可以得到以下结果:

-- -------------------- ---- -------
----- ----- - ----- --- -- -
  ----- -------- - ----- -----------
  ------ ----------------
--

----- ------- - ----- ---- -- -
  --- -
    ----- ------------- - ----- --------------
    ------ --------------
  - ----- ------- -
    ---------------------
  -
--

----- --- - ----- -- -- -
  ----- ---- - ----- -------------------
  ----- ------------- - ----- --------------
  ------ --------------
--

如上所示,函数变量名已被修改。

总结

虽然 babel-plugin-transform-function-composition-name 插件的功能较为简单,但它可以帮助开发人员更好地理解代码中的函数调用。通过学习和使用这个插件,可以提高代码编写和维护的效率。

来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/60055da681e8991b448db667

纠错
反馈